Very strange game. I didn't think either team played well. Except for about 5 long plays, the Steelers couldn't move the ball on offense. Seattle had no trouble moving the ball, but were dismal in the red zone.. and didn't look like they'd ever heard of a 2 minute offense.
I've never believed anyone should blame officials for losing. Officials have always missed calls, and it's part of the game to play well enough to overcome those if they happen to go against your team. There were some questionable calls in this one that might have made a big difference. The review didn't appear to show Bettis scoring their first TD on 3rd down and the official initially marked him down short of the goal line and then changed his mind. The offensive interference against Jackson that nullified a TD and the holding call on the pass to the Steelers 1 yard line were both questionable at best. But Seattle has to be able to play well enough to overcome those things if they expect to win.
